Best sports docu-series to watch on OTT

1. The Greatest Rivalry: India vs Pakistan

Where to watch: Netflix

IMDb rating: 6.5/10

About the movie: India vs Pakistan cricket matches are always considered iconic ones, creating history in both countries. Available to watch in Hindi, Tamil, Telugu and English, the series traces the cricketing rivalry between India and Pakistan, exploring their intricate past and uncertain future on the pitch.

2. The Last Dance

Where to watch: Netflix

IMDb rating: 9/10

About the movie:The docuseries chronicles the rise of NBA superstar Michael Jordan and the 1990s Chicago Bulls. The Last Dance follows the Bulls' 1997-98 season from start to finish, while exploring other chapters of Jordan's life - from high school team to a cultural figure.

3. Mr McMahon

Where to watch: Netflix

IMDb rating: 7.7/10

About the movie: The web series delves into the record-breaking success of Vince McMahon and WWE. It also explores the controversies surrounding him and his leadership in the rise and fall of WWE. The docuseries aims to provide a comprehensive look at McMahon's legacy and his impact on the wrestling world.

4. Untold: The Murder of Air McNair

Where to watch: Netflix

IMDb rating: 5.6/10

About the movie: The documentary explores the rise of legendary NFL quarterback Steve McNair and the puzzling details about his murder in 2009.

5. Senna: No Fear, No Limits, No Equal

Where to watch: Netflix

IMDb rating: 8.5/10

About the movie: Senna: No Fear, No Limits, No Equal is a fast-paced documentary that profiles the rise to success of one of the greatest drivers in the history of Formula One racing, Ayrton Senna, who was also a hero in his native Brazil.

6. Kareem: Minority of One

Where to watch: JioHotstar

IMDb rating: 7.4/10

About the movie: Kareem: Minority of One is an award-winning documentary that chronicles the life and career of one of basketball's most celebrated athletes, Kareem Abdul-Jabbar.

7. Beckham

Where to watch: Beckham

IMDb rating: 8.1/10

About the movie: The docu-series Beckham explores the life and rise to fame of iconic football player David Beckham. As he juggles family life amid the limelight, his friction with Sir Alex Ferguson grows until he finds his footing with Real Madrid.

8. Ben Stokes: Phoenix from The Ashes

Where to watch: Amazon Prime Video

IMDb rating: 8.1/10

About the movie: Ben Stokes: Phoenix from The Ashes is a documentary that chronicles the life of extraordinary cricketer Ben Stokes. Directed by Chris Grubb and Luke Mellows, the documentary shows the life of Ben with interviews and insights by Sam Mendes.
